    Abstract

    An apparatus for converting a snowboard to a longboard-type skateboard. The resulting longboard combines the properties of a snowboard with those of a skateboard to provide a unique ride. The longboard-skateboard conversion kit uses a board from either a new or reclaimed source; skateboard truck assemblies; and one or more support structure(s) made of firm but flexible materials that allow strength to account for longer length; flexion, rebound, stability and vibration-damping.

    DETAILED DESCRIPTION OF THE DRAWINGS

    (5) FIG. 1 and FIG. 2 show a longboard-skateboard deck 110 fitted with two sets of trucks 112, supporting wheels 114, and two straight support braces 116 that have midsections near the longboard-skateboard's centerline 118. The embodiment comprises a middle section 130, a front section 128 with a curve beginning near section line 122 and ending near section line 120, and a back section 132 comprised of a curve beginning near section line 124 and ending near section line 126.

    (6) FIG. 3 and FIG. 4 show a longboard-skateboard deck 210 fitted with two sets of trucks 212, supporting wheels 214, and two curved support braces 216 that follow the edge contour of the longboard-skateboard deck. A tangent line 217 extends from each support brace 216 proximal to the center of its radius. Tangent lines 217 are substantially parallel to the longboard-skateboard centerline 218. The longboard-skateboard comprises a middle section 230; a front section 228 that curves from section line 222 to section line 220, and a back section 232 that curves from section line 224 to section line 226.
